Amer Fort: Royal Romance Redefined

Perched on a hill overlooking Maota Lake, Amer Fort is Jaipur’s crown jewel for couples. This 16th-century UNESCO site dazzles with Sheesh Mahal’s mirror work, where candlelight once reflected like stars for royal trysts.

Wander through elephant stables, Diwan-e-Aam halls, and terraced gardens hand-in-hand. Early mornings offer fewer crowds, perfect for photos amid pink sandstone arches. In 2026, light-and-sound shows evenings add a magical narrative touch.​

Ascend via elephant or jeep ride for panoramic views—sunrise here feels eternal. Nearby Panna Meena Ka Kund stepwell provides a serene post-fort dip into history, with symmetrical steps ideal for couple selfies.

Jal Mahal: Sunset’s Serene Embrace

Floating like a mirage on Man Sagar Lake, Jal Mahal enchants with its five-story silhouette against Nahargarh hills. Built in the 18th century, only the top floor peeks above water, sparking legends of submerged romance.

Couples adore sunset hours when the palace glows golden, winds whispering secrets. Stroll the promenade, savor kulfi from vendors, or opt for boat rides (₹30-50/person in 2026) for closer views. Birds flocking at dusk amplify the poetry.​

No entry inside, but surrounding gardens host picnics. Pair with nearby Nahargarh for a full evening—pure bliss.​

Nahargarh Fort: Panoramic Love Overlooks

Nahargarh’s rugged perch offers Jaipur’s best city vistas, especially at twilight when lights twinkle below. Constructed in 1734 for defense, its terraces now host whispered promises amid ancient walls.

Hike or drive up for 360-degree sweeps including Jal Mahal and old town. Weekdays ensure privacy; evenings feature Padao restaurant for candlelit Rajasthani thalis (₹800-1200/couple).​

City Palace: Regal Intimacy

Heart of Jaipur, City Palace blends museums, courtyards, and Chandra Mahal towers. Maharaja Sawai Jai Singh’s 18th-century abode houses Mubarak Mahal with textiles whispering royal tales.

Couples cherish peacocks in gardens, silver urns (world’s largest), and Pritam Chowk’s painted doors. Guided tours (₹200 extra) unveil love stories behind latticed windows.​

Afternoons suit relaxed exploration; nearby Jantar Mantar adds astronomical romance.​

Hawa Mahal: Breeze-Kissed Facades

Hawa Mahals’ five-story honeycomb facade, built in 1799 for royal ladies, lets cool breezes through 953 jharokhas. Couples climb for Siredeori Bazaar views, imagining veiled glances.

Pink sandstone glows at dusk; pair with rooftop cafes like Peacock (₹1000/dinner) for Hawa-lit meals.​

Gardens of Serenity: Sisodia Rani and More

Sisodia Rani Garden, crafted in 1728 for a queen, terraces fountains and frescoes depicting Radha-Krishna romances. Multi-level paths suit leisurely walks; evenings alive with water channels.

Nearby Kanak Vrindavan offers temple-gardens; Smriti Van’s biodiversity trails, waterfalls host picnics amid 300+ bird species.​

Central Park near Statue Circle provides jogging tracks, massive flagpole—urban oasis for morning chats.

Cultural Delights: Chokhi Dhani and Beyond

Chokhi Dhani recreates village life with folk dances, camel rides, puppet shows. Rajasthani thalis (₹1500/couple) under stars feel festive-romantic.

Patrika Gate’s colorful arches scream Instagram joy; Albert Hall Museum’s lit-up Indo-Saracenic dome suits evenings.

Birla Mandir’s marble glows white; Jaigarh Fort’s Jaivana cannon adds adventure minus crowds.​
